- Abstract
- As a part of recent CO2 emission reduction studies in the concrete industry with active use of concrete admixtures with low basic unit of CO2 emission such as blast furnace slag (BFS), basic unit of CO2 emission by SBFS was computed in order to assess CO2 emission by reinforced concrete building with smart blast furnace slag (SBFS). In addition, SBFS concrete was applied to the subject building for assessment of CO2 emission during material production step among construction steps. Life cycle CO2 emission assessment on the subject building was classified into 7cases according to mix ratio of BFS and SBFS.
